ZIP codes with heat-related hospitalizations, ER visits

These ZIP codes are based on where patients resided in 2017 when they had a heat-related illness in which they sought medical attention. The rate per 100,000 people was calculated by dividing the number of heat-related hospitalizations and ER visits into the estimated population. The higher the rate, the darker the color.

Hospital and ER data is from Healthcare Cost and Utilization Project and the Florida Agency for Health Care Administration. Population by zip code (2018) is from Esri and the U.S. Census Bureau. ZIP codes in white may indicate a lake or an area without a ZIP code. ZIP codes in grey did not meet the threshold of more than 10 cases of heat-related illness.
